New president for Mercantile Bank

Mercantile Bank has named a new interim President and CEO.

Ted T. Awerkamp, who has served as President and CEO and also as Chairman of the Mercantile Bank since 2007 is no longer with the bank.

Lee R. Keith has been appointed as the acting and interim President and CEO of Mercantile Bancorp, Inc. and Chairman of Mercantile Bank.

As stated in a press release, the appointment is contingent on the approval of the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ation and Federal Reserve Bank.

"We are pleased to have someone of Lee Keith's experience join our management team," said Michael J. Foster, Chairman of the Company. "Lee's over 33 years in the banking industry and, in particular, his leadership in restoring six problem banks to a financially sound position make him an excellent leader to move Mercantile forward in these difficult times."
